This Act is enacted under the provisions of Section 209 of the Constitution and to the extent that it regulates or restricts a right or freedom referred to in Subdivision III.3.C (qualified rights) of the Constitution, namely—
(a) the right to freedom from arbitrary search and entry conferred by Section 44 of the Constitution; and
(b) the right to privacy conferred by Section 49 of the Constitution; and
(c) the right to freedom of information conferred by Section 51 of the Constitution,
is a law that is made for the purpose of giving effect to the public interest in public order and public welfare; and
(d) the right to freedom of movement conferred by Section 52 of the Constitution.
